Litecryptoinvest.com is currently under suspicion for operating as a fraudulent investment scheme. The site promises prospective investors large returns on their capital. However, once funds are committed, the culprits abscond with the money. Strangely, there are no reviews available for the company on any of the major consumer review platforms. Several pages on the website are still under construction, filled with generic text and placeholder content. Advertised partnerships on the site are not genuine. Furthermore, it has been identified that the images used on the site are not authentic.

Investment scams are schemes that lure individuals to invest their money with promises of high returns. These schemes often involve fraudsters who disappear with the investors’ money after they’ve invested.

An investment scam is a fraudulent business activity. It happens when someone tricks you into putting money into a fake investment. These scams often promise high returns to lure you in. The scammer might use complex jargon and documents. This can make their scheme look like a legitimate investment opportunity. They may also pressure you to invest quickly, or promise guaranteed returns. These are red flags and you should be cautious. In many cases, once the scammer has your money, they disappear. Leaving you with no way to get your money back. It's important to do your own research before investing. Don't trust unsolicited investment offers. Remember, if it sounds too good to be true, it probably is.
